Did you see the video of Ian McIntosh falling down an Alaskan Mountain? It went viral a few weeks ago. The ABC news story on that fall showed him wearing a Buff®. A quick Google search reveals that he seems to love Buff®. He’s definitely not sponsored by Buff®. I assume he just uses it […]
